Boca Raton dropped their record down to 12-7 on Tuesday, which also ended the team's five-game streak of wins at home. They took a 9-5 hit to the loss column at the hands of the Calvary Christian Academy Eagles. The Bobcats were given a dose of their own medicine in this game as the Eagles apparently hadn't forgotten their defeat the last time these teams played back in February of 2017.
Audrey Brandao was cooking despite her team's loss, going 2-for-3 with two RBI, one run, and one double. Another player making a difference was Raegan Lisco, who got on base in three of her four plate appearances with one RBI.
As for Calvary Christian Academy, they are on a roll lately: they've won ten of their last 12 games. That's provided a nice bump to their 11-5 record this season. The team dominated over that stretch too, winning by an average of 13.4 runs.
On Calvary Christian Academy's side, Reese Mittauer made a big impact no matter where she played. On the mound, she didn't allow a single earned run while striking out 11 over seven innings pitched. Mittauer was also solid in the batter's box, going 2-for-4 with two runs, two doubles, and one stolen base. Those two doubles gave her a new career-high.
In other batting news, the team relied heavily on Sofia Fine, who went a perfect 4-for-4 with three stolen bases, three runs, and one triple. Those four hits gave her a new career-high. The team also got some help courtesy of Gabriella Bird, who went 2-for-4 with two stolen bases and one run.
Coming up, Boca Raton will head out on the road to face off against Spanish River at 6:30 p.m. on Wednesday. The Sharks will aim to continue their three-game streak of scoring more runs each matchup than the last. Calvary Christian Academy does not have any more games scheduled as of now.
